Hello all,
What types of insurances do I need for opening a nail salon?

Many thanks
 
I have a combined policy , all tailored to my business needs.
For yourself it will be something like the following
Buildings, fixtures and fittings.
Stock and equipment cover.
Public and product liability
Medical malpractice.
Then there can be add ons;- all subject to what you want or need.
Such as;- Increased personal accident for the therapist.
Extra cover for more expensive itmes in the salon.
All tailored to your needs.
Are you fully qualified in nails? I ask because normally a good training college will generally have interests in helping improve standards and thus attach a professional membership with an insurance company. So it makes it easy to gain the right insurance for what you have been trained to do. Maybe your training provider could recommend a specific insurer.
